whitling

/ˈhwɪt.lɪŋ/

Definitions

1. noun

the act of cutting or shaping wood or other hard material using a sharp knife, typically for decorative or functional purposes.

“He spent his afternoon engaged in whittling a wooden figurine.”

Synonyms

  • carving
  • woodcarving
